

Bourget College U18 forward Victor Morrissette-Richer has committed to Union College, it was announced late last week.
A product of Outremont, Que., Morrissette-Richer just finished his first season with the team, collecting 13 goals and 15 assists for 28 points in 24 regular season games. Having also gotten into five playoff games, Morrissette-Richer put up two assists.
Drafted by the Moncton Wildcats in the fourth round of the 2024 QMJHL Entry Draft, Morrissette-Richer spent his draft-eligible season playing for College Notre-Dame M18 D1, scoring 12 goals and adding 18 assists for 30 points in 25 games.
With Morrissette-Richer not heading to the NCAA for another couple years, he will have a strong chance to make an impact in the QMJHL before then. A skilled player who does a good job finding open space in the slot, Morrissette-Richer has the skills required to make a difference on the scoresheet.
